Xin chào, tôi đã nâng cấp tất cả các gói trên Ubuntu và kernel cũng vậy. Nhưng trong quá trình nâng cấp, nâng cấp kernel không thành công và tôi phải luôn luôn tải grub chọn kernel cũ hơn. Đó là một lệnh đầu cuối để cài đặt lại kernel mới nhất?
Xin chào, tôi đã nâng cấp tất cả các gói trên Ubuntu và kernel cũng vậy. Nhưng trong quá trình nâng cấp, nâng cấp kernel không thành công và tôi phải luôn luôn tải grub chọn kernel cũ hơn. Đó là một lệnh đầu cuối để cài đặt lại kernel mới nhất?
Câu trả lời:
Chạy lệnh sau trong một thiết bị đầu cuối ( Ctrl+ Alt+ T):
dpkg -l | grep linux-image-.*-generic
Tìm phiên bản kernel bạn muốn cài đặt lại, sau đó chạy:
sudo apt-get install --reinstall linux-image-3.X.Y-ZZ-generic
Tất nhiên, bạn phải nhập phiên bản kernel thực tế (ví dụ: linux-image-3.8.0-21-generic) thay vì linux-image-3.XY-ZZ-generic.
dpkg -l | grep linux-image-.*-generic | sort -k3 | tail -n1 | awk '{system ("sudo apt-get install --reinstall " $2)}'